Our verdict is Likely benign. Variant got -2 ACMG points: 2P and 4B. PM2BP4_Strong
The NM_001376312.2(GTDC1):c.580G>A(p.Gly194Ser)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000548 in 1,459,338 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/21 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).
GTDC1 (HGNC:20887): (glycosyltransferase like domain containing 1) Predicted to enable glycosyltransferase activity. [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]

The c.580G>A (p.G194S) alteration is located in exon 7 (coding exon 4) of the GTDC1 gene. This alteration results from a G to A substitution at nucleotide position 580, causing the glycine (G) at amino acid position 194 to be replaced by a serine (S).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
